出 处:《精细化工》2008年第5期499-504,共6页Fine Chemicals
摘 要:以研究孤岛注聚原油乳状液破乳为目的,通过瓶试法和界面性质的测定,筛选了多种类型的原油破乳剂,考察了破乳剂质量浓度、聚合物和原油组分对破乳效果的影响,探讨了原油乳状液的破乳机理。结果表明,破乳剂BF-069质量浓度在100mg/L,50℃条件下,脱水率达到70%以上,现场温度稍微升高,脱水率达到85%左右,破乳剂BF-069已在胜利油田应用,现场使用效果良好;聚合物质量浓度在50mg/L时,原油乳状液最难破乳;原油中不同组分对破乳效果的影响不同,油水界面性质的测定表明,胶质和沥青质是影响原油破乳的主要因素。In order to eliminate the Gudao water-in-crude oil emulsion formed by polymer flooding, many demulsifiers were studied by measuring the change of water content in the emulsion. The mass concentration of the demulsifier, the polymer and components of the crude oil were. tested to check the effect of demulsification. The interfacial surface tension and interfacial shear viscosity were studied so as to announce the effect of additive on the interfacial property between the crude oil and water. With demulsifier BF - 069 in dosage of 100 mg/L at 50 ℃, the separation of water from water - in - crude oil emulsion reached 70% . while the result of field test was higher than 85% due to increase of temperature. Demulsifier BF - 069 has been successfully adopted in Shengli oil field. When the mass concentration of polymer is 50 mg/L, demulsification is most difficult. The interfacial properties demonstrate that gum and asphaltene in crude oil are the dominant factors which affect the breakdown of emulsion.
关 键 词:破乳剂 聚合物 原油乳状液 界面性质 胶质 沥青质
